Supported versions: VirtueMart 4.6.0

Supported versions: VirtueMart 4.6.0

ShopSite to VirtueMart Migration - Step-by-Step Guide & Expert Services

ShopSite to VirtueMart migration doesn't have to be complicated. If you're ready to move ShopSite store to VirtueMart, Cart2Cart offers the most reliable solution. Our service ensures a swift, secure, and seamless transfer of your data, guaranteeing complete SEO preservation and zero downtime for your business. Whether you're exploring how to switch from ShopSite to VirtueMart with our step-by-step guide, or prefer our professionals to transfer data effortlessly, we support both approaches. Begin your confident ShopSite to VirtueMart migration now.

Set it up in minutes

What data can be
migrated from ShopSite to VirtueMart

The price of your migration depends on the volume of data to migrate and the additional migration options you pick. To check the price for ShopSite to VirtueMart conversion, click “Get estimates” and follow the suggested steps.

How to Migrate from ShopSite to VirtueMart In 3 Steps?

Connect your Source & Target carts

Choose ShopSite and VirtueMart from the drop-down lists & provide the stores’ URLs in the corresponding fields.

Select the data to migrate & extra options

Choose the data you want to migrate to VirtueMart and extra options to customise your ShopSite to VirtueMart migration.

Launch your Demo/Full migration

Run a free Demo to see how the Cart2Cart service works, and when happy - launch Full migration.

Migrate Your Store: A Step-by-Step Guide from ShopSite to VirtueMart

Seamlessly Transitioning from ShopSite to VirtueMart

As an e-commerce merchant, the decision to replatform your online store is a significant one. If you're currently operating on ShopSite and looking to move to the robust and flexible VirtueMart platform, you're making a strategic choice towards enhanced scalability and a richer feature set, particularly benefiting from Joomla's content management capabilities. This comprehensive guide will walk you through the entire process of migrating your valuable store data, including products, customer information, orders, and more, from ShopSite to VirtueMart.

We understand that data transfer can seem daunting, but with the right approach and a trusted migration solution, you can ensure a smooth transition with minimal downtime and optimal data integrity. Follow these actionable steps to confidently switch your e-commerce presence and leverage the full potential of your new VirtueMart store.

Prerequisites for a Successful Migration

Before initiating the data migration process, a few essential preparations will ensure a smooth and efficient transition from ShopSite to VirtueMart. Taking these preliminary steps seriously will save you time and prevent potential issues down the line.

  • VirtueMart and Joomla Installation: Ensure you have a fully installed and configured Joomla instance with VirtueMart ready on your target server. This will be the destination for all your ShopSite data.
  • Access Credentials: You will need administrative access to both your ShopSite store and your new VirtueMart (Joomla) installation. This includes FTP/SFTP access to upload the connection bridge files. Read our guide on The Short & Essential Guide to Access Credentials for Cart2Cart for more details.
  • Backup Your Data: While data migration services prioritize safety, it's always best practice to create a full backup of your existing ShopSite store. This ensures you have a recovery point for all your product SKUs, customer records, and order histories.
  • Review ShopSite Limitations: Be aware of any specific limitations your ShopSite version might have, such as "SEO options excluded for blogs," which might require manual adjustment post-migration.
  • Install Cart2Cart ShopSite Migration Module: As ShopSite utilizes a "Bridge only" connection method, you will be required to install the Cart2Cart ShopSite Migration module. This plugin facilitates the secure data exchange between your ShopSite store and the migration service.

Preparing your stores beforehand simplifies the process greatly. For more information, refer to our FAQs: How to prepare Source store for migration? and How to prepare Target store for migration?

Performing the Migration: A Step-by-Step Guide

This section outlines the step-by-step process of migrating your e-commerce store from ShopSite to VirtueMart using a dedicated migration wizard.

Step 1: Initiate Your Migration

Your migration journey begins by accessing the migration wizard. This intuitive interface is designed to guide you through each stage of the data transfer process.

Step 2: Connect Your ShopSite Store (Source Setup)

The first crucial step is to connect your existing ShopSite store. Select 'ShopSite' as your Source Cart type from the dropdown menu. Since ShopSite uses a "Bridge only" connection method, you will be prompted to provide your store's URL and upload a connection bridge.

Important: The ShopSite data table specifies "Cart2Cart ShopSite Migration module required." You will download a connection bridge file from the migration wizard, unpack it, and then upload the 'bridge2cart' folder to the root directory of your ShopSite store via FTP. This bridge acts as a secure gateway, allowing the migration service to access your data.

Step 3: Configure Your VirtueMart Store (Target Setup)

Next, configure your target VirtueMart store. Select 'VirtueMart' as your Target Cart type and provide its URL. Similar to the source store, you will need to download and upload a connection bridge (usually named 'bridge2cart') to the root directory of your VirtueMart (Joomla) installation via FTP. This bridge is essential for the migration service to write data to your new store.

Ensure the bridge is uploaded correctly to establish a successful connection. If you are unsure about the root folder, consult our FAQ: What is a root folder and where can I find it?

Step 4: Select Data Entities for Migration

In this step, you'll choose precisely which data entities you want to transfer from ShopSite to VirtueMart. The migration service supports a wide range of data, ensuring a comprehensive move of your e-commerce assets. You can select all entities or pick them individually based on your specific requirements.

  • Products: Including product details, SKUs, variants, attributes, and images.
  • Product Categories: Your organizational structure for products.
  • Product Manufacturers: Associated brand information.
  • Product Reviews: Valuable customer feedback.
  • Customers: All customer data, including billing and shipping addresses.
  • Orders: Complete order history and statuses.
  • Invoices: Corresponding invoice records.
  • Taxes: Tax rules and configurations.
  • Stores: Information related to your store setup (if applicable).
  • Coupons: Discount codes and promotions.
  • CMS Pages: Static content pages.

Step 5: Map Data Fields

Data mapping is a critical step to ensure consistency between your old ShopSite store and the new VirtueMart platform. Here, you will match corresponding customer groups and order statuses from your source store to their equivalents in the target VirtueMart store. This guarantees that your customer roles and order processing workflows are correctly replicated.

Step 6: Choose Additional Migration Options

This step allows you to fine-tune your migration with a variety of powerful additional options. These features are designed to enhance your data transfer and optimize your new store's performance from day one.

  • Preserve IDs: Options to "Preserve Product IDs," "Preserve Category IDs," "Preserve Orders IDs," and "Preserve Customers IDs" help maintain SEO continuity and external linking. Learn more about How Preserve IDs options can be used?
  • Migrate Customer Passwords: Securely transfer customer passwords, ensuring a seamless login experience for your existing customer base.
  • Create 301 SEO Redirects: Automatically generate 301 redirects for your old ShopSite URLs to their new VirtueMart counterparts. This is vital for preserving your SEO rankings and link equity.
  • Migrate Images in Description: Ensure all product images embedded within descriptions are transferred.
  • Clear Target Store Data: If your VirtueMart store already contains demo data, you can choose to "Clear current data on Target store before migration" to start fresh.
  • Create Variants from Attributes: If your ShopSite products use attributes that should become variants in VirtueMart, this option handles the conversion.
  • Migrate Invoices: Transfer all your existing invoice records.

Step 7: Run Demo and Full Migration

Before committing to the full migration, it's highly recommended to run a free demo migration. This transfers a limited number of entities (e.g., 20 products, customers, orders) to your VirtueMart store, allowing you to preview the results and ensure everything functions as expected. This step is crucial for verifying data integrity and formatting.

Once you're satisfied with the demo results, you can proceed with the full migration. At this stage, you also have the option to select a Migration Insurance Plan, which offers additional re-migrations in case you need to adjust or re-run the process. How Migration Insurance works?

Post-Migration Steps: Activating Your New VirtueMart Store

Completing the data transfer is a major milestone, but a few critical post-migration tasks remain to ensure your new VirtueMart store is fully operational and optimized.

  • Thorough Testing: Dedicate time to meticulously test every aspect of your new VirtueMart store. Verify product pages, check out the shopping cart and payment gateways, create test customer accounts, and place sample orders. Ensure all customer data, orders, and taxes are accurately displayed.
  • Configure Theme and Extensions: Install and configure your chosen VirtueMart theme and any necessary extensions or plugins. This includes setting up shipping methods, payment gateways, and any custom functionalities your business requires.
  • Update DNS Records: Once you're confident in your VirtueMart store's functionality, update your domain's DNS records to point to your new VirtueMart hosting. Plan this step to minimize downtime for your live store.
  • Implement 301 Redirects: If you didn't utilize the 301 redirect option during migration, or if you have specific URL changes, implement them manually or with a Joomla/VirtueMart extension. This is crucial for preserving SEO rankings and guiding visitors from old ShopSite URLs to their new destinations.
  • SEO Optimization: Review your VirtueMart store's SEO settings. Update meta titles, descriptions, and ensure image alt texts are correctly configured. Maintain your link equity by checking for broken links.
  • Delete Old Store (Optional): Once your VirtueMart store is fully live and stable, you can consider decommissioning your old ShopSite store.
  • Ongoing Data Synchronization: For any new orders or customer data that might have come in during the transition period, consider a Recent Data Migration Service to ensure no information is lost.

Congratulations on successfully migrating your e-commerce store from ShopSite to VirtueMart! If you encounter any challenges or require further assistance, don't hesitate to Contact Us or browse our extensive Frequently Asked Questions.

Ways to perform migration from ShopSite to VirtueMart

Automated migration

Just set up the migration and choose the entities to move – the service will do the rest.

Try It Free
Automated Migration

Data Migration Service Package

Delegate the job to the highly-skilled migration experts and get the job done.

Choose Package
Service Package
Customers

Benefits for Store Owners

Ecommerce Agencies

Benefits for Ecommerce Agencies

Clear Target Store data before migration

Will delete all data from your VirtueMart store

Create product variants based on the combinations of options

Or the available attribute values combination

Move images from products, categories, blog posts descriptions

Those included in the descriptions

Set products quantity to 100 on VirtueMart store

To check how the migration works for out of stock products

Migrate categories and products SEO URLs

Keep your ShopSite URL structure on VirtueMart

Preserve category IDs on Target Store

Your ShopSite category IDs will be the same in VirtueMart

Preserve customer IDs on Target Store

Your ShopSite customer IDs will be the same in VirtueMart

Choose all the extra migration options and get 40% off their total Price

Try it now
Migration Limitations

The design and store functionality transfer is impossible due to ShopSite to VirtueMart limitations. However, you can recreate it with the help of a 3rd-party developer.

4.9 Total Score
500+ reviews

ShopSite to VirtueMart Migration Video Tutorial

Let’s figure out everything about ShopSite to VirtueMart migration through Cart2Cart.

Your data is safely locked with Cart2Cart

We built in many security measures so you can safely migrate from ShopSite to VirtueMart. Check out our Security Policy

Server Security

All migrations are performed on a secure dedicated Hetzner server with restricted physical access.

Application Security

HTTPS protocol and 128-bit SSL encryption are used to protect the data being exchanged.

Network Security

The most up-to-date network architecture schema, firewall and access restrictions protect our system from electronic attacks.

Data Access Control

Employee access to customer migration data is restricted, logged and audited.

Frequently Asked Questions

Should I use an automated tool or hire an expert for ShopSite to VirtueMart migration?

An automated tool like Cart2Cart is cost-effective and efficient for standard migrations, requiring the Cart2Cart ShopSite and VirtueMart Migration modules. For complex stores or if you prefer a hands-off approach, hiring an expert for our Ultimate Data Migration Service provides dedicated assistance, handling all technicalities of the ShopSite to VirtueMart move.

Is my data secure during the ShopSite to VirtueMart migration process?

Absolutely. We prioritize your data's security with encrypted connections and strict protocols. Your ShopSite data is never stored on our servers longer than necessary, ensuring a safe and confidential transfer to VirtueMart. Read our Security Policy for detailed information on data protection measures.

Can customer passwords be migrated from ShopSite to VirtueMart?

Direct password migration from ShopSite to VirtueMart is generally not supported due to varying encryption methods and security best practices. However, we offer options to migrate customer data and implement password reset mechanisms post-migration. Explore Customer Password Migration insights.

How long does a ShopSite to VirtueMart migration take?

The duration depends on your data volume. A typical migration can range from a few hours for small stores to several days for large ones. The Bridge connection method for both platforms ensures a streamlined transfer. A Migration Preview Service helps estimate the exact timeline for your ShopSite to VirtueMart transfer.

How can I ensure data accuracy after migrating from ShopSite to VirtueMart?

Post-migration, it's crucial to validate your data. We recommend performing a demo migration first to check data integrity. After the full transfer, thoroughly review products, orders, and customer details on your new VirtueMart store. An external server handles the process, maintaining original data integrity.

What factors influence the cost of migrating from ShopSite to VirtueMart?

Migration cost depends on the number of entities (products, customers, orders), complexity of custom fields, and additional options like 301 redirects. Both ShopSite and VirtueMart use a Bridge connection method, requiring their respective modules. You can get a precise estimate for your Basic Data Migration Service via our migration wizard.

How to protect SEO rankings when migrating from ShopSite to VirtueMart?

We preserve your SEO by migrating URLs, meta data, and 301 redirects from ShopSite to VirtueMart. This ensures search engines can seamlessly follow your content to the new store, safeguarding your organic traffic, even though ShopSite has limitations on blog SEO options. Migrate SEO URLs with Cart2Cart to retain your rankings.

How do I transfer my store's design and theme from ShopSite to VirtueMart?

Store design and themes are not migrated as data entities. After your ShopSite data moves to VirtueMart, you'll need to select or customize a new VirtueMart theme. This allows for a fresh, updated look and ensures compatibility with VirtueMart's Joomla integration. Consider a custom or pre-made e-Commerce template.

Will my ShopSite store go offline during migration to VirtueMart?

No, your ShopSite store remains fully operational. The migration process runs on a secure, external server via a Bridge connection, ensuring zero downtime. Your current customers won't experience any interruption. Our Security Policy details data protection.

What data entities can I migrate from ShopSite to VirtueMart?

You can transfer products, product images, categories, customers, orders, and more. While ShopSite has limitations on multi-store features, core eCommerce data will move to VirtueMart. A Universal eCommerce Migration Checklist helps outline transferable entities. Note that VirtueMart requires Joomla integration.

Why 150.000+ customers all over the globe have chosen Cart2Cart?

100% non-techie friendly

Cart2Cart is recommended by Shopify, WooCommerce, Wix, OpenCart, PrestaShop and other top ecommerce platforms.

Keep selling while migrating

The process of data transfer has no effect on the migrated store. At all.

24/7 live support

Get every bit of help right when you need it. Our live chat experts will eagerly guide you through the entire migration process.

Lightning fast migration

Just a few hours - and all your store data is moved to its new home.

Open to the customers’ needs

We’re ready to help import data from database dump, csv. file, a rare shopping cart etc.

Trusted by eCommerce dominators since 2009

slide 1 of 3
slide 1 to 2 of 3
  • Testimonial Person: Photo
  • Testimonial Person: Photo
  • Testimonial Person: Photo
  • Testimonial Person: Photo
  • Testimonial Person: Photo
KIRK DICKINSON
Online store owner

I had used Cart2Cart 3 years ago for a migration from OSCommerce to Joomla/Virtuemart. I struggled with Virtuemart for 3 years and am sick of it. So remembering the good job they did 3 years ago, I had them migrate my data from VirtueMart to WooCommerce. Everything went smoothly except my photos didn’t get transferred correctly. I emailed them and gave them FTP access and they got everything fixed right up. I think they went out of their way to get my stuff up and going. I will use them again when I get sick of WooCommerce unless it works like it is supposed to
Review source

  • Testimonial Person: Photo
  • Testimonial Person: Photo
  • Testimonial Person: Photo
  • Testimonial Person: Photo
  • Testimonial Person: Photo
WILLIAM SCHAEPE
Online store owner

You were wonderful. Very helpful. You did the demo migration and now are doing the full migration. This is saving days of work on my part in moving the data in VirtueMart to the the new version. I have other clients that will be using VirtueMart and we will need your service for them. I will mention your service in the Joomla and VirtueMart forums.
Review source

  • Testimonial Person: Photo
  • Testimonial Person: Photo
  • Testimonial Person: Photo
  • Testimonial Person: Photo
  • Testimonial Person: Photo
FRANZ-PETER SCHERER
Online store owner

This service is just great. I actually migrate my oscommerce shop to virtuemart and of course I want to keep my customers and orders. So I did decide to use cart2cart service to do that task. The result is impressive. Everything worked without any problem.



I can recommend that service to everybody. It works great.

Thank you.
Review source

  • Testimonial Person: Photo
  • Testimonial Person: Photo
  • Testimonial Person: Photo
  • Testimonial Person: Photo
  • Testimonial Person: Photo
HARDIK PATEL
Online store owner

Great Solution! Excellent Support team which helped to migrate my store data from Magento to Bigcommerce in no time. Cart2Cart developed a custom solution to which helped me to Migrate my Blog Data too. I will surely use their service on my upcoming projects.
Review source

  • Testimonial Person: Photo
  • Testimonial Person: Photo
  • Testimonial Person: Photo
  • Testimonial Person: Photo
  • Testimonial Person: Photo
JESSICA KORYBUT
Online store owner

Migration from Shopify to BigCommerce was exactly what I need it. Customers information, orders, products description and images were displayed in my new platform perfectly. Additionally, the support team were very helpful and patience while I was doing all of this process. I highly recommend it!
Review source

  • Testimonial Person: Photo
  • Testimonial Person: Photo
  • Testimonial Person: Photo
  • Testimonial Person: Photo
  • Testimonial Person: Photo
JEREMY WILSON
Online store owner

Working with Cart2Cart on a recent Yahoo Store to BigCommerce Store migration was a pleasure. The support was very helpful in getting to my end solution. I would definitely recommend their service for anyone looking to migrate data between these platforms.
Review source

  • Testimonial Person: Photo
  • Testimonial Person: Photo
  • Testimonial Person: Photo
  • Testimonial Person: Photo
  • Testimonial Person: Photo
DEVELOPER TEAM
Online store owner

Solid work on the cart2cart migration from Magento to BigCommerce! Also, they helped me a lot for the data re-migration due to an accidental deletion on BigCommerce I definitely would recommend Cart2Cart 🙂
Review source

  • Testimonial Person: Photo
  • Testimonial Person: Photo
  • Testimonial Person: Photo
  • Testimonial Person: Photo
  • Testimonial Person: Photo
BEN FRIDAY
Online store owner

I have been very happy with the service and support of Cart2Cart in migrating from an older WebAsyst based e-commerce site to a much more modern CS-Cart based one. Worked perfectly!
Review source

  • Testimonial Person: Photo
  • Testimonial Person: Photo
  • Testimonial Person: Photo
  • Testimonial Person: Photo
  • Testimonial Person: Photo
UMAIR ZAMAN
Online store owner

Very good support. They migrated our store from Big Cartel to Magento, and were very cooperative during all this process. Thank you team. I recommend them to everyone
Review source

  • Testimonial Person: Photo
  • Testimonial Person: Photo
  • Testimonial Person: Photo
  • Testimonial Person: Photo
  • Testimonial Person: Photo
PETER JAAP BLAAKMEER
Online store owner

I have successfully used Cart2Cart to migrate products & categories from DrupalCommerce to Magento. It’s easy, affordable and they offer decent support (no I’m not affiliated with them).
Review source